摘要: 目录 1. 序言 2. 序列化的目的? 2.1 场景: 3. java实现Serializable接口 4. serialVersionUID 4.1 private static final long serialVersionUID = 1L; 的意义 5. 为什么保存到数据库或者文件中要序列化 阅读全文
posted @ 2020-04-05 11:14 魏晋南北朝 阅读(4234) 评论(0) 推荐(0) 编辑
摘要: 1、发现无用对象 引用计数 被应用时,计数器++,通过计数器判断是否被引用(循环引用) 把引用关系作为一张图,搜索根。(建图或者建树) 2、回收无用对象 通用的垃圾分代回收机制 将对象分为年轻代,年老代,持久代 jvm划分为将堆划分为: Eden :新建对象先放至eden,满了就触发垃圾回收(min 阅读全文
posted @ 2020-04-05 11:00 魏晋南北朝 阅读(104) 评论(0) 推荐(0) 编辑